NEWS
Test Adapter sun2000 v0.1.x - Huawei Wechselrichter
-
servus das ist die Google KI , wenn die etwas für mich sucht/findet , lasse ich mir Ursprung und Zitat geben hier : smarthems aus 2024
-
@Michael-Birr ich kann leider das Reg 37001 in der modbus Definition der Emma nicht finden.
@bolliy
hab ich ja geschrieben.Steht in der Inv.Modbus Doku:

-
p.s. aus release Beta V2.3.6 : Anzeige Bat. Temp. funktioniert bei INV 1 + 2 aber nicht bei INV 0 ??
Screenshot 2026-02-15 at 16-44-44 objects - WIN-3K5OLN5KJIS.png NV. 0 ?? -
danke erst einmal
-
Tatsächlich eine Halluzination - aber sehr überzeugend - habe KI dazu gebracht, mir die Datengrundlage zu nennen :
SmartHEMS V100R024C00 MODBUS Interface Definitions.pdf
die kannte ich zwar (aber nicht jede Zeile) - war natürlich kein Beleg für reg. 37000737001 vorhanden. WIEDER einmal etwas gelernt.
Wie geschieht so etwas : ich denke, wenn die Datengrundlage zu klein ist um über die Menge zu validieren. -
Tatsächlich eine Halluzination - aber sehr überzeugend - habe KI dazu gebracht, mir die Datengrundlage zu nennen :
SmartHEMS V100R024C00 MODBUS Interface Definitions.pdf
die kannte ich zwar (aber nicht jede Zeile) - war natürlich kein Beleg für reg. 37000737001 vorhanden. WIEDER einmal etwas gelernt.
Wie geschieht so etwas : ich denke, wenn die Datengrundlage zu klein ist um über die Menge zu validieren.@Michael-Birr frag die KI doch selbst ;)
https://share.google/hMa3fQvsF13Y1AMMq -
passt schon Stephan , das Leben ist ein Lernprozess. Aber du kannst mir trotzdem weiterhelfen : ich bräuchte im Adapter eine FIXE Anzeige für Offgrid des systems hinter smartguard > grund : Notfallsteuerung meiner WP ( Frostschutz ) vielleicht fällt dir dazu etwas ein . danke im vorraus
-
passt schon Stephan , das Leben ist ein Lernprozess. Aber du kannst mir trotzdem weiterhelfen : ich bräuchte im Adapter eine FIXE Anzeige für Offgrid des systems hinter smartguard > grund : Notfallsteuerung meiner WP ( Frostschutz ) vielleicht fällt dir dazu etwas ein . danke im vorraus
@Michael-Birr ich bin mir nicht sicher, aber eigentlich müsstest du den deviceStatus des ersten Inverters überprüfen.
sun2000.0.inverter.0.deviceStatus
oder als Klartext
sun2000.0.inverter.0.derived.deviceStatus
Siehe: https://github.com/bolliy/ioBroker.sun2000/blob/9859e3c67af219746e77a67fdbd337f51a38d681/lib/types.js#L11Im sun2000.0.inverter.0.derived.alarmJSON müsste der Fehler des Netzverlustes auch auftauchen.
Siehe: https://github.com/bolliy/ioBroker.sun2000/blob/main/lib/alarms.jsAnsonsten beim Huawei Service nachfragen..
Stephan
-
danke werde ich mir genau ansehen !
-
Ich habe den Adapter installiert und bin auch glücklich damit. Danke dafür.
Die Emma 02 nutze ich um die Werte zu erfassen. Ich dachte es gab da im Wiki / Doku mal ein Bild welche Variablen was bedeuten und wofür man diese in einem Energieflussdiagramm benutzt. Leider finde ich das Bild nicht, täusche ich mich da und es gab das gar nicht oder wo finde ich es? -
-
Hallo,
danke auch für den schönen Adapter.Ich habe eine Frage zur Steuerung der Erzwungenen Batterieladung. Muss ich die benötigten Register über ein externes Script selbst ansteuern, oder ist dafür in diesem Adapter etwas vorhgesehen?
Danke für die Hilfe.
Uwe
-
Hallo,
danke auch für den schönen Adapter.Ich habe eine Frage zur Steuerung der Erzwungenen Batterieladung. Muss ich die benötigten Register über ein externes Script selbst ansteuern, oder ist dafür in diesem Adapter etwas vorhgesehen?
Danke für die Hilfe.
Uwe
steht alles im wiki:
https://github.com/bolliy/ioBroker.sun2000/wiki/Erzwungenes-Laden-und-Entladen-der-Batterie-(Force-charge-discharge-battery)oder in der diskussion:
https://github.com/bolliy/ioBroker.sun2000/discussions/200Ich habe dies per Script gelöst, in der VIS dann so (steht auch in og. discuss)

-
Neue Testversion sun2000 Adapter Version v2.4.0 released.
Die Installation erfolgt über npm oder morgen über das Beta Repository.
Neues Statistik-Modul im sun2000 Adapter
Der Adapter sammelt ab sofort automatisch Energie- und Verbrauchsdaten und bereitet sie zeitlich auf – ohne dass der Nutzer etwas konfigurieren muss.
Was passiert im Hintergrund
Jede Stunde speichert der Adapter einen Schnappschuss der wichtigsten Werte. Daraus baut er automatisch Tages-, Wochen-, Monats- und Jahreswerte zusammen. Die Daten werden dabei aufsummiert und alte Einträge regelmäßig bereinigt.
Welche Werte werden erfasst
PV-Ertrag, Hausverbrauch, Netzbezug, Netzeinspeisung sowie Batterie-Laden und -Entladen aus dem collected Pfad - also alle relevanten Energieflüsse der Anlage.
Wo werden die Statistikdaten gespeichert
Unter sun2000.x.statistics.* erscheinen fünf neue States:jsonHourly - Stundenwerte der letzten 2 Tage
jsonDaily - Tageswerte des laufenden Jahres
jsonWeekly - Wochenwerte des laufenden Jahres
jsonMonthly - Monatswerte des laufenden Jahres
jsonAnnual - Jahreswerte seit InbetriebnahmeDiese JSON-States lassen sich direkt in VIS, jarvis, Lovelace oder per Blockly/JavaScript auslesen und als Diagramme darstellen – ganz ohne eigene History-Abfragen oder Datenbankanbindung.
Was bisher nötig war
Für solche Auswertungen musste man bisher selbst ioBroker.history, InfluxDB oder SQL einrichten und die Abfragen manuell schreiben. Das entfällt nun für die wichtigsten PV-Kennzahlen.
Ausblick
Die Integration mit dem ioBroker.flexcharts-Adapter ist bereits vorbereitet. Damit sollen die Daten künftig mit wenigen Klicks als fertige Diagramme in VIS dargestellt werden können.Hier der entsprechende Wiki-Eintrag: https://github.com/bolliy/ioBroker.sun2000/wiki/Statistk-(statistics)
LG Stephan
Changelog
• fix: the order of bit assignment corrected of alarmsJSON
• new state inverter.x.emma.activeAlarmSN and inverter.x.emma.HistoricalAlarmSN : emma alarms #226
• statistics: Aggregates historical collected datapoints into time-based summaries (e.g. hourly, daily, monthly, yearly). The data is stored in the path statistics as JSON.